The correct answers are A. Written in an elevated language, B. Celebrates the life of a legendary hero and E. Is a long narrative

Explanation:

The Epic poetry is a type of poetry that originated in Ancient Grece and that was mainly used to narrate the actions of a hero or heroine, especially in relation to extraordinary deeds that implied struggling against supernatural forces and represented a positive example of moral. Because of this, it was common epic poems were long narratives as they do not only celebrated the life and features of a hero or heroine but tells the actions and story behind them. Additionally, to this, it was common epic poems were written in a complex elevated language or highly stylized language, considering these poems combined the lyrical and dramatic traditions found in other forms of literature such as plays or myths. Considering this, the main characteristics of an epic poem were (A) written in complex or elevated language that mixes different literary styles, (B) use to celebrate the actions and features of a hero and (E) long narrative as the story of the hero including the difficulties faced were explained.

How did permanent settlements impact the social structure of early civilizations
-BARSIC- [3]

Answer:

Permanent settlements led to population increases. As populations grew, societies became more complex, as well as some social institutions that are older than civilization, but that fully developed in early civilizations: division of labor, social hierarchy, and even slavery.

In other words, as early civilizations became more complex, the relative egalitarianism of nomadic and semi nomadic societes disappeared.

Which European city was known in the early seventeenth century as a haven for persecuted Protestants from all over Europe and ev
olasank [31]

Answer:

It was Amsterdam, in the Netherlands.  It became a sanctuary for Huguenots, the French Calvinists, who suffered persecution in France, and also for Jews who had flown from Spain and Portugal where their options were to convert or to be burned. There they could settle and worship. Jews invested in the local stock market and opened synagogues in Amsterdam.
